the cheersquad has got alot smaller. in my 1st few years it was noisy with lots of flags etc. it has been the past 3-5 years where the cs has got smaller and quieter. the cheersquad use to go to row P but now i think it goes to M. but still alot of empty seats in it each game. if they are spare or people are not there is a mystery, but come finals time its always full.

yea in the cheersquad there is the guy that leads the chants (peter) and some other kid who is about 15 (he stands up and chants) but after that good luck in finding someone else that chants. most people are there just for the grand final tickets.

Why does the cheersquad actively try and compete with the noise made by the boys up the back rather than join them? I see and hear it time and again from my seats in M30. The boys at the back start a chant and so the cheer squad feels they have to start a chant in competition to them. Half the time it's the same chant but started later so we end up with two competing groups trying to get the same chant going and as a result they both fail to gain much support.
